LCRO Liquid CRO
LCRO (Liquid CRO) is a yield-bearing receipt token issued by Veno, a liquid staking protocol operating on the Cronos blockchain. When users stake CRO through Veno, they receive LCRO in return, which automatically accrues the underlying CRO staking yield as the protocol compounds rewards on their behalf. This design allows holders to maintain exposure to staking returns while freeing up the token for use across the broader Cronos decentralized finance ecosystem. Beyond its liquid staking function, LCRO is built for composability, meaning it can serve as collateral, a trading pair, or an input for other DeFi applications without forfeiting the staking yield it carries. The protocol supports its operation through its own node infrastructure as well as partner-operated nodes, aiming to keep fees low and reliability high. Veno also includes an insurance module intended to help protect user funds in the unlikely event of a slashing penalty on the underlying validator set. Together, these features position LCRO as a utility token within the Cronos liquid staking category, bridging native staking with broader on-chain activity.
